Fonctionnalités de base de données prises en charge. SAP Logiciel, logiciel de base de données, utilitaires informatiques, ordinateurs et électronique
4.3.1 Fonctionnalités de base de données prises en charge
Le serveur de connexion prend uniquement en charge les procédures stockées qui renvoient les données sous forme d'ensembles de résultats, c'est-à-dire de tables. Cela signifie qu'une procédure stockée ne peut pas renvoyer d'entiers, de chaînes ou de curseurs et qu'elle doit toujours contenir des instructions SELECT. En outre, les procédures stockées ne doivent pas contenir de paramètre SORTIE ou ENTREE/SORTIE. De plus, les instructions COMPUTE, PRINT, OUTPUT ou STATUS contenues dans les procédures stockées ne sont pas exécutées.
Attention
Ces restrictions ne sont pas valides pour les procédures stockées Oracle. Pour en savoir plus sur les procédures stockées Oracle prises en charge, consultez la section suivante.
Le serveur de connexion prend en charge les procédures stockées Oracle dans un package. Le nom du package est renvoyé en tant que nom du catalogue. Ce comportement s'applique pour les couches réseau Oracle CI et
JDBC
Pour en savoir plus sur l'utilisation des procédures stockées, reportez-vous au Guide de l'utilisateur de l'outil de
conception d'univers.
4.3.2 Procédures stockées Oracle
Les procédures stockées Oracle prises en charge sont les suivantes :
● procédures PL/SQL renvoyant des ensembles de résultats via un curseur REF ;
● procédures stockées PL/SQL avec un paramètre de variable de curseur REF ENTREE/SORTIE et pas de paramètre SORTIE.
Remarque
Les autres paramètres de curseur ENTREE/SORTIE de la procédure sont ignorés.
Les procédures stockées Oracle non prises en charge sont les suivantes :
● procédures PL/SQL ne renvoyant pas d'ensembles de résultats via un paramètre de CURSEUR REF ;
● procédures PL/SQL avec au moins un paramètre SORTIE ;
● fonctions PL/SQL ;
● procédures PL/SQL avec un paramètre ENTREE/SORTIE de type différent du paramètre de CURSEUR REF, par exemple, VARRAY ;
● fonctions de table PL/SQL.
Pour accéder aux procédures stockées Oracle, vous devez effectuer plusieurs tâches à la fin du serveur pour permettre à la plateforme de BI de se connecter à une procédure stockée. Les sections suivantes expliquent ce processus.
Guide d'accès aux données
Spécificités de l'accès aux données
©
2013 SAP AG ou société affiliée SAP. Tous droits réservés.
25

Lien public mis à jour
Le lien public vers votre chat a été mis à jour.